در دنیای پرشتاب فناوری اطلاعات و با رشد بیسابقه دادهها، سیستمهای ذخیرهسازی نقش حیاتی در بقا و کارایی سازمانها ایفا میکنند. در گذشتهای نه چندان دور، HP EVA (Enterprise Virtual Array) یکی از راهکارهای برجسته و پرکاربرد شرکت HP (که بعدها به HPE تبدیل شد) در زمینه شبکههای ذخیرهسازی (SAN) بود. این سری از استوریجها با تمرکز بر مجازیسازی ذخیرهسازی و مدیریت سادهتر دادهها، توانستند جایگاه ویژهای در مراکز دادههای متوسط تا بزرگ پیدا کنند.
هرچند که خط تولید HP EVA در حال حاضر توسط HPE بازنشسته شده و جای خود را به فناوریهای نوینتری مانند HPE 3PAR و HPE Nimble Storage داده است، اما شناخت این سری از استوریجها به دلیل تاریخچه و تاثیرگذاری آنها بر تکامل ذخیرهسازی سازمانی، همچنان از اهمیت بالایی برخوردار است. در این مقاله جامع، به معرفی کامل استوریجهای HP EVA میپردازیم؛ از تاریخچه و مدلهای مختلف گرفته تا مزایا، کاربردها و محدودیتهایی که این سیستمها در زمان خود داشتند. با ما همراه باشید تا نگاهی عمیق به این بخش از تاریخ ذخیرهسازی HP داشته باشیم و ببینیم چگونه این فناوریها راه را برای نسلهای بعدی هموار کردند.
۱. تاریخچه و تکامل HP EVA: از آغاز تا دوران بازنشستگی
داستان HP EVA با کمپانی Compaq در اوایل دهه 2000 میلادی آغاز شد. Compaq، یکی از بازیگران اصلی در صنعت سرور و ذخیرهسازی آن زمان، با معرفی سری EVA 3000/5000 گامهای اولیه را در جهت مجازیسازی ذخیرهسازی برداشت. هدف اصلی این سیستمها، متمرکز کردن منابع ذخیرهسازی (Storage Pooling) و سادهسازی مدیریت آنها بود. این رویکرد در آن زمان نسبتاً نوآورانه محسوب میشد، زیرا به مدیران IT اجازه میداد تا فضای ذخیرهسازی را بدون نگرانی از پیچیدگیهای دیسکهای فیزیکی، مدیریت کنند.
پس از خریداری Compaq توسط HP، خط تولید EVA تحت برند HP ادامه یافت و به سرعت توسعه پیدا کرد. نسلهای بعدی EVA با بهبودهای قابل توجهی در مقیاسپذیری (Scalability)، عملکرد (Performance) و ارائه قابلیتهای پیشرفتهتر مانند مجازیسازی (Virtualization) و اسنپشات (Snapshots) همراه بودند.
مراحل اصلی تکامل HP EVA:
- نسل اول (اوایل 2000): HP EVA 3000/5000 Series
- متمرکز بر Storage Pooling و مدیریت ساده.
- استفاده از شلفهای دیسک 3U با 14 درایو Fibre Channel (FC-AL).
- نسل دوم (حدود اواسط 2000): HP EVA 4100/6100/8100 Series
- پیشرفت قابل توجه در مقیاسپذیری و عملکرد.
- معرفی و بهبود قابلیتهایی مانند مجازیسازی و اسنپشات.
- استفاده از کنترلرهای HSV2x0.
- نسل سوم (اواخر 2000 و اوایل 2010): HP EVA 4400/6400/8400 Series
- بهبودهای بیشتر در مقیاسپذیری و عملکرد.
- معرفی قابلیتهای جدیدی مانند Thin Provisioning (تخصیص فضای دیسک به صورت پویا و به اندازه نیاز) و Online LUN Migration (مهاجرت آنلاین LUNها بدون وقفه).
- استفاده از شلفهای دیسک 2U با 12 درایو و پشتیبانی از درایوهای Fibre-ATA (FATA).
- کنترلرهای HSV300، HSV400 و HSV450.
- نسل چهارم (آخرین نسل): HP EVA P6300/P6500 Series (همچنین به عنوان EVA P6000 شناخته میشود)
- آخرین تکامل از خط تولید EVA.
- استفاده از رابط SAS برای اتصال دیسکها (SAS-enabled disk shelves).
- پشتیبانی از درایوهای Small Form Factor (SFF) و Large Form Factor (LFF).
- بهبودهای بیشتر در کش (Cache) و پورتهای اتصال به هاست.
با این حال، با ظهور فناوریهای جدیدتر و نیاز به عملکرد بالاتر و ویژگیهای پیشرفتهتر مانند All-Flash Arrays و قابلیتهای Hybrid Cloud، شرکت HP (که در سال 2015 به HPE – Hewlett Packard Enterprise تغییر نام داد) تصمیم گرفت خط تولید EVA را به تدریج بازنشسته کرده و تمرکز خود را بر روی پلتفرمهای مدرنتری مانند HPE 3PAR StoreServ و HPE Nimble Storage بگذارد. این استوریجها با معماریهای جدیدتر، عملکرد بهینه و قابلیتهای پیشرفتهتر، پاسخگوی نیازهای رو به رشد مراکز داده امروزی هستند. با این وجود، بسیاری از سازمانها سالها از استوریجهای EVA استفاده کردند و این سیستمها نقش مهمی در زیرساختهای فناوری اطلاعات آنها ایفا کردند.
۲. معماری و اجزای اصلی HP EVA
استوریجهای HP EVA بر اساس یک معماری مجازیسازی دیسک (Disk Virtualization Architecture) طراحی شده بودند که آنها را از سیستمهای RAID سنتی متمایز میکرد. اجزای اصلی یک سیستم EVA عبارت بودند از:
- کنترلرها (Controllers – HSV Series):
- این واحدها مغز متفکر سیستم EVA بودند. هر سیستم EVA دارای یک جفت کنترلر (Dual Controllers) برای افزونگی (Redundancy) و قابلیت دسترسی بالا (High Availability – HA) بود.
- کنترلرها مسئول مدیریت تمامی عملیات ورودی/خروجی (I/O) دادهها، مجازیسازی دیسکها، مدیریت RAID و ارائه Logical Units (LUNs) به سرورها بودند.
- مدلهای مختلف کنترلر (مانند HSV200, HSV300, HSV400, HSV450 و در نهایت HSV340/360 برای P6000) با هر نسل EVA به روز میشدند.
- قفسههای دیسک (Disk Enclosures/Shelves):
- این قفسهها شامل درایوهای فیزیکی (HDD) بودند. با هر نسل، طراحی و نوع دیسکهای پشتیبانی شده نیز تغییر میکرد.
- در نسلهای اولیه، از درایوهای Fibre Channel (FC-AL) استفاده میشد، اما در نسلهای بعدی (مانند P6000) به رابط SAS (Serial Attached SCSI) منتقل شدند که سرعت و مقیاسپذیری بیشتری را ارائه میداد.
- این شلفها معمولاً در فرم فاکتورهای 2U یا 3U طراحی میشدند و تعداد مشخصی دیسک (مثلاً 12 یا 14 دیسک) را در خود جای میدادند.
- نرمافزار مدیریت (Management Software – HP Command View EVA):
- HP Command View EVA نرمافزار اصلی برای مدیریت و پیکربندی سیستم EVA بود. این نرمافزار یک رابط کاربری گرافیکی (GUI) بصری برای مدیران فراهم میکرد تا بتوانند:
- منابع ذخیرهسازی را پیکربندی کنند.
- دیسکهای مجازی (Virtual Disks) یا LUNs را ایجاد و مدیریت کنند.
- مکانیزمهای حفاظت از دادهها مانند اسنپشات و رپلیکیشن (Replication) را تنظیم کنند.
- عملکرد سیستم را نظارت و مشکلات را عیبیابی کنند.
- HP Command View EVA نرمافزار اصلی برای مدیریت و پیکربندی سیستم EVA بود. این نرمافزار یک رابط کاربری گرافیکی (GUI) بصری برای مدیران فراهم میکرد تا بتوانند:
- فریمور (Firmware – XCS – eXtensible Controller Software):
- سیستمعامل کنترلرها با نام XCS (eXtensible Controller Software) شناخته میشد. این فریمور، قابلیتهای مجازیسازی و مدیریت هوشمند دادهها را در EVA فراهم میکرد.
- نسخههای مختلف XCS با هر نسل EVA سازگار بودند و ویژگیهای جدیدی را ارائه میدادند.
- اتصال به هاست (Host Connectivity):
- EVA از طریق پروتکل Fibre Channel (FC) به سرورها متصل میشد. در نسلهای جدیدتر (مانند P6000)، پشتیبانی از iSCSI و FCoE (Fibre Channel over Ethernet) نیز اضافه شد تا انعطافپذیری بیشتری در اتصال به شبکه فراهم شود.
۳. مزایای اصلی استوریج HP EVA (در زمان خود)
استوریجهای HP EVA در دوران فعالیت خود، مزایای قابل توجهی را برای سازمانها به ارمغان میآوردند که آنها را به یک انتخاب محبوب تبدیل کرده بود:
- مجازیسازی دیسک و سادگی مدیریت (Virtualization & Simplicity):
- یکی از بزرگترین نقاط قوت EVA، رویکرد مجازیسازی آن بود. به جای مدیریت RAID گروههای دیسکی سنتی، EVA تمامی دیسکها را به عنوان یک استخر ذخیرهسازی (Storage Pool) واحد مدیریت میکرد.
- این مجازیسازی باعث میشد ایجاد و گسترش LUNها بسیار سادهتر شود، زیرا نیازی به پیکربندی دستی RAID یا نگرانی در مورد مکان فیزیکی دادهها نبود. EVA به صورت خودکار دادهها را بین دیسکها توزیع میکرد.
- افزونگی و قابلیت دسترسی بالا (Redundancy & High Availability):
- تمامی اجزای حیاتی (کنترلرها، پورتها، منابع تغذیه) به صورت دوگانه (Dual) و افزونه طراحی شده بودند تا در صورت خرابی یک جزء، سیستم بدون وقفه به کار خود ادامه دهد.
- عملکرد مطلوب (Good Performance):
- EVA با بهرهگیری از معماری مبتنی بر کنترلرهای دوگانه و کش (Cache) بزرگ، عملکرد مناسبی را برای بارهای کاری متنوع ارائه میداد.
- قابلیت Vraid (Virtual RAID) که دادهها را بین تعداد زیادی دیسک (مثلاً 8 تا 240 دیسک) توزیع میکرد، باعث افزایش تعداد اسپیندلهای دیسک در عملیات I/O و در نتیجه بهبود عملکرد میشد.
- مدیریت آسان از طریق Command View EVA:
- نرمافزار HP Command View EVA یک رابط کاربری گرافیکی (GUI) بسیار بصری و کاربرپسند داشت که مدیریت سیستم را حتی برای مدیران با تجربه کمتر نیز ساده میکرد.
- قابلیتهای حفاظت از داده (Data Protection Features):
- Snapshots (Copy-on-Write): امکان ایجاد کپیهای لحظهای از دادهها برای بکآپگیری یا تست، با حداقل فضای اشغالی.
- Replication (Continuous Access): قابلیتهای رپلیکیشن محلی و از راه دور برای بازیابی فاجعه (Disaster Recovery).
- Thin Provisioning:
- در نسلهای جدیدتر (مانند EVA 4400/6400/8400 و P6000)، Thin Provisioning معرفی شد که به سازمانها اجازه میداد تا فضای دیسک را به صورت مجازی بیش از ظرفیت فیزیکی تخصیص دهند. این امر بهینهسازی استفاده از ظرفیت و کاهش هزینهها را در پی داشت.
- مقیاسپذیری (Scalability):
- EVA قابلیت مقیاسپذیری خوبی داشت و میتوانست با افزودن قفسههای دیسک و درایوها، ظرفیت خود را افزایش دهد. برخی مدلها تا صدها درایو را پشتیبانی میکردند.
۴. کاربردهای اصلی استوریج HP EVA
در زمان اوج خود، استوریجهای HP EVA در طیف وسیعی از محیطهای سازمانی مورد استفاده قرار میگرفتند. کاربردهای اصلی آنها عبارت بودند از:
- مجازیسازی سرور (Server Virtualization):
- یکی از رایجترین کاربردهای EVA، تامین فضای ذخیرهسازی برای محیطهای مجازیسازی شده مانند VMware vSphere و Microsoft Hyper-V بود. قابلیتهای Thin Provisioning و Snapshot EVA به خوبی با نیازهای ماشینهای مجازی همخوانی داشت.
- پایگاههای داده (Databases):
- EVA با ارائه عملکرد مناسب و قابلیتهای حفاظت از داده، یک انتخاب محبوب برای میزبانی پایگاههای دادههای حیاتی مانند Microsoft SQL Server و Oracle بود.
- ایمیل و Collaboration (Exchange, SharePoint):
- سیستمهای ایمیل و برنامههای همکاری که نیاز به فضای ذخیرهسازی بزرگ و با دسترسی بالا داشتند، از EVA بهره میبردند.
- File Services (خدمات فایل):
- EVA میتوانست به عنوان بستر ذخیرهسازی برای فایل سرورهای سازمانی عمل کند و فضای متمرکز و ایمن برای دادههای کاربران فراهم آورد.
- پشتیبانگیری و بازیابی (Backup & Recovery):
- قابلیتهای اسنپشات و رپلیکیشن EVA، آن را به ابزاری مفید برای فرآیندهای پشتیبانگیری سریع و بازیابی دادهها در صورت بروز مشکل تبدیل کرده بود.
- محیطهای تست و توسعه (Test & Development Environments):
- با استفاده از قابلیت اسنپشات، میتوانستند به سرعت کپیهایی از محیطهای تولید ایجاد کنند و آنها را برای تست و توسعه استفاده نمایند، بدون اینکه بر سیستم اصلی تأثیری بگذارند.
- Disaster Recovery (بازیابی فاجعه):
- قابلیت Continuous Access EVA (رپلیکیشن از راه دور) به سازمانها اجازه میداد تا دادههای خود را به یک سایت بازیابی فاجعه منتقل کرده و در صورت بروز فاجعه در سایت اصلی، سرویسها را از طریق سایت ثانویه بازیابی کنند.
۵. محدودیتها و دلایل بازنشستگی HP EVA
هرچند HP EVA در زمان خود یک محصول نوآورانه و موفق بود، اما با پیشرفت سریع فناوری و تغییر نیازهای بازار، محدودیتهایی نیز داشت که در نهایت منجر به بازنشستگی آن شد:
- محدودیتهای عملکردی در نسلهای اولیه:
- نسلهای قدیمیتر EVA، به خصوص در بارهای کاری بسیار سنگین و تصادفی (Random I/O)، نمیتوانستند عملکردی در حد رقبای پیشرفتهتر ارائه دهند.
- وابستگی به Fibre Channel (در ابتدا):
- در حالی که FC یک پروتکل قدرتمند بود، پیچیدگی و هزینه آن نسبت به iSCSI و بعدها Ethernet، برای برخی سازمانها چالشبرانگیز بود. اگرچه نسلهای جدیدتر از iSCSI و FCoE پشتیبانی کردند، اما میراث FC در آنها باقی ماند.
- عدم پشتیبانی از All-Flash Arrays (در ابتدا):
- با ظهور دیسکهای SSD و نیاز به استوریجهای تمام فلش (All-Flash Arrays) برای عملکرد فوقالعاده بالا، معماری EVA بهینهسازی کافی برای این فناوری را نداشت. نسلهای جدیدتر HPE (مانند 3PAR و Nimble) از ابتدا برای All-Flash طراحی شدهاند.
- هزینه نگهداری و گسترش (در مقایسه با گزینههای جدیدتر):
- با گذشت زمان و معرفی راهکارهای جدیدتر و با بهرهوری بالاتر، هزینههای نگهداری و گسترش EVA در مقایسه با فناوریهای جدیدتر کمتر توجیهپذیر شد.
- مدیریت پیچیدهتر در مقایسه با نسلهای بعدی:
- هرچند Command View EVA رابط کاربری سادهای داشت، اما در مقایسه با پلتفرمهای مدیریتی یکپارچهتر و هوشمندتر نسلهای جدیدتر HPE (مانند HPE OneView و InfSight)، مدیریت EVA نیازمند دانش تخصصیتر و پیچیدگیهای بیشتری بود.
- فقدان قابلیتهای پیشرفته هوش مصنوعی و یادگیری ماشین:
- سیستمهای ذخیرهسازی مدرن مانند HPE Nimble Storage با استفاده از هوش مصنوعی و یادگیری ماشین (InfSight) قادر به پیشبینی مشکلات، بهینهسازی عملکرد و سادهسازی عیبیابی هستند که این قابلیتها در EVA وجود نداشت.
- پایان عمر (End-of-Life – EOL):
- در نهایت، HPE تصمیم گرفت خط تولید EVA را رسماً به پایان عمر (EOL) برساند و پشتیبانی و تولید قطعات آن را متوقف کند. این امر سازمانها را وادار به مهاجرت به پلتفرمهای جدیدتر کرد.
نتیجهگیری: میراث HP EVA در دنیای ذخیرهسازی
استوریجهای HP EVA در دوران خود، نقش بسیار مهمی در تکامل فناوری ذخیرهسازی در مراکز داده ایفا کردند. آنها با رویکرد نوآورانه خود در مجازیسازی دیسک و سادهسازی مدیریت SAN، به بسیاری از سازمانها کمک کردند تا از پیچیدگیهای سنتی ذخیرهسازی رهایی یابند و زیرساختی با کارایی و دسترسپذیری بالا ایجاد کنند. مدلهای مختلف این سری، از EVA 3000/5000 گرفته تا نسلهای پیشرفتهتر مانند P6000، هر یک با بهبودهایی در عملکرد و قابلیتها همراه بودند.
امروزه، هرچند که HP EVA دیگر توسط HPE تولید و پشتیبانی نمیشود و جای خود را به راهحلهای پیشرفتهتری مانند HPE 3PAR و HPE Nimble Storage داده است، اما میراث آن در شکلگیری سیستمهای ذخیرهسازی مدرن غیرقابل انکار است. شناخت این فناوریها نه تنها به درک تاریخچه IT کمک میکند، بلکه دیدگاهی ارزشمند درباره چگونگی تکامل نیازهای سازمانی و پاسخگویی فناوری به آنها فراهم میآورد. HP EVA نمونهای از یک محصول موفق بود که در زمان خود، به بهترین نحو به نیازهای بازار پاسخ داد و راه را برای نوآوریهای آینده هموار ساخت.